WebAug 7, 2024 · Time series prediction problems are a difficult type of predictive modeling problem. Unlike regression predictive modeling, time series also adds the complexity of a sequence dependence among the input variables. A powerful type of neural network designed to handle sequence dependence is called a recurrent neural network. WebOct 28, 2024 · Deep neural networks, often criticized as “black boxes,” are helping neuroscientists understand the organization of living brains. Computational neuroscientists are finding that deep learning neural networks can be good explanatory models for the functional organization of living brains. WebApr 4, 2024 · In Intuitive Deep Learning Part 1a, we said that Machine Learning consists of two steps. The first step is to specify a template (an architecture) and the second step is to find the best numbers from the data to fill in that template. Our code from here on will also follow these two steps. WebOverview [ edit] A biological neural network is composed of a group of chemically connected or functionally associated neurons. A single neuron may be connected to many other neurons and the total number of neurons and connections in a network may be extensive.
